    In my school, we take “blurting” very seriously but we actually call it “retrieval practice”. when you write everything down that you know without your notes, essentially you are retrieving the information from your short term memory into your long term memory. it’s a very effective revision strategy and I’m glad you mentioned it. also, thank you so much for the amazing tips! loved the video:)

    1. Understand the question+ what it requires of you.
    2. Stay away from taught structures such as P.E.E. Let you analysis include lexical fields, symbolic meaning, literal meaning, words + connotations and ALWAYS a language device.
    3. Make a unique, out of the box point.

      I’m taking RE and I've gotten an 8- or an 8 on every mock and assessment so far. There are certain ways to structure your paragraphs which will ensure you have given enough info to get all the marks.
      First there is PEPE which is Point - Explain - Point - Explain and it is for the 4 mark question, basically you make a point and then back it up with an explanation, its best to include a religious teaching or an attitude in the explanation as it makes it flow better. And you repeat this once so your answer looks like, Point - Explain - Point - Explain, but make sure the second point is quite different from the first.
      e.g "Give 2 contrasting Christian viewpoint on abortion"
      P - [Some Christians would be against abortion because once of the ten commandments is "Do not kill"]
      E - [As abortion is the termination of the foetus it can be seen as murder and would go against "Do not kill"]
      P - [Some Christians would be accepting of abortion if the pregnancy endangers the health of the mother]
      E - [Pregnancy can occasionally lead to the death of the woman, as Christians believe God loves all individuals, abortion may be considered to spare god from the suffering]
